Olivier Desenfans

Results 53 comments of Olivier Desenfans

I concur, the handling of the various status codes surprises me. I see at least 2 different use cases: 1. Different schemas for different situations (ex: success, failure) 2. Different...

After giving it a bit more thought, I've come up with the following solution: 1. Force the return value of endpoints decorated with `responds` to be a tuple of (`data`,...

> To quote another somewhat related principle from the zen of Python, special cases are not special enough to break the rules. I would say that this is not a...

@thomaseizinger I'm just shutting the peer down, which would explain the warning indeed. I haven't seen it yet, what's the idiomatic way to shut down the connection in rust-libp2p?

Thanks a lot for the suggestions, I'll try them out and see if the warning persists.

So, I looked into the docs and tried to implement a graceful disconnection before shutting down the application. To my understanding of the docs, the only public method available to...

> For a graceful shutdown of the streams within gossipsub, I think it may depend on the underlying StreamMuxer and whether it can gracefully close streams. Are you using yamux...

Is anyone working on this? If not, I could try to tackle it myself but I'd need a few pointers to get me started.

I can also confirm that this issue occurs in our project with aiohttp 3.8.3 and Python 3.11.

> There aren't too many changes (if you ignore formatting/typing changes), so if anyone can take a look and figure out which change is the issue, that'd be great. These...